SUMMARY: We don’t know who he is, or where he comes from. Dressed in a white combination, he wanders the country roads on his bike. Fate leads it to a deep French village freshly marked by the death of a child, broken by a two-wheel. Very quickly, the stranger feels indifference, then contempt and soon the hatred of these villagers confined to their prejudices. Only Madeleine, single mother, agrees to come to help her. But all the men of the village, to the mayor, have found abroad their scapegoat.
ABOUT THE MOVIE: In the right line of Hunting scenes in Bavaria (1969), hate is a reflection on intolerance, xenophobia and human stupidity, worn by a Klaus Kinski at the top of his art. By his side, we find the familiar faces of the French cinema of the 1970/80’s, among which Maria Schneider (The last tango in Paris), Evelyne Bouix and Katia Tchenko. Atypical work, allegory allegory, HAINE is presented as a world premiere in a fully restored version, on DVD and Blu-Ray.
